Transaction 39aaf78520972dcb634a0af77f342f3accc152517ec6bcfdbc1e4a5214937b11

1 Input
2 Outputs
  • 39aaf78520972dcb634a0af77f342f3accc152517ec6bcfdbc1e4a5214937b11:0
  • value  30520671
    address  3CpSoArkTHEcgYoLBzpaXRhHS6DtcjUjjp
  • 39aaf78520972dcb634a0af77f342f3accc152517ec6bcfdbc1e4a5214937b11:1
  • value  185268918
    address  1PVKLQqDFgXAeREmXWGqDeAWAg4MkuUA7e